Web15 de ago. de 2024 · How child care providers can support language development in children with hearing disabilities Language is an essential skill for all children. Whether they learn to speak, use sign language or combine the two, children with hearing disabilities can develop important language skills with practice. Our programmes are highly … clover 5144WebPromote good health beyond your family. Other adults may play a role in your child's life, too. You can share ideas about healthy habits with them. For instance, many parents and caregivers work outside the home and need others to help with childcare.
